25 | On 03/25/24 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Lizeth Villegas conducted an unannounced annual required visit, LPA met with DSP-Lynda McCullough as the purpose of today’s visit was explained. The facility is licensed to serve 7 developmentally disabled clients (age 18-59), current census is 6. clients are linked to the South Central Regional Center, all (6) residents are Ambulatory. DSP provided with upcoming facility fees info.
The home is located in a residential area and consist of a two-story structure in an apartment complex, apartments "C" and "D". Apt. "C” includes only the upstairs, which has 3 shared bedrooms, two bathrooms, living rooms and (2) staff offices. Apt. "D" includes both the downstairs and upstairs, with the kitchen, pantry and dining room located on the lower level, which also has one client bedroom, staff bedroom and one bathroom. The facility has a garage that consist of washer/dryer unit, staff refrigerator, an additional freezer, a storage area for hygiene supplies and toxins.
LPA conducted a records review of 2 staff records, 2 client records and 2 Medication Administration Records, LPA did not observe any discrepancies at the time of visit. Medications were centrally stored and properly locked, first aid kit was checked and fully stocked. The last fire drill was conducted on 02/01/2024, 4 fire extinguishers fully charged, carbon monoxide detectors observed, smoke detectors are operational. Land line was observed.
All client rooms were checked, mattresses and box springs were in good condition, adequate lighting, plenty of dresser and closet space was observed. Bathrooms were found to be within Title 22 regulation, toilets and water faucets worked properly, showers are free of mold/mildew, and there are sufficient toiletries accessible to clients. The water temperature properly measured between 105-120 F.. Perishable and non-perishable food supply was checked and adequately stocked at time of visit. Knifes were observed to be locked and inaccessible to clients. There are no firearms nor bodies of water on the premises. Exits/ Walkways around the facility were free of debris and hazards. During today’s visit no discrepancies were cited.
Exit interview conducted with DSP-Lynda McCullough, and a copy of this report was provided.
